Ghostbusters (2016)
Great reboot
I'm a 40-y-o guy whose favorite movie is the original Ghostbusters. I don't know who all these haters are, but they don't represent anyone I know. Their claims that the new movie is sexist and racist are contradicted by the movie itself, which is neither. Rather, it seems that these haters living in their moms' basements are just saying, "nyuh-uh, you are!" when confronted with their blatant misogyny and racism directed toward this movie. The poor trailers have been used by these people to cover up their true agenda, but now people are seeing for themselves that the new movie, while not the classic that the original is, is still a great supernatural comedy with chills and thrills. It doesn't "ruin" the original any more than "Ghostbusters II" did, and is a lot better than that movie. I'm looking forward to more!
Effing Brutal: The Full Motion Video Graphic Novel (2009)
Garbage
I'd looked at some of the director's other videos, and they were terrible. So when I saw he had put his "talent" toward a 132-page graphic novel (turned into this 2-hour film), with all the time and effort that involves, curiosity got the best of me. Well, I can now say that all that time and effort were wasted. This story, an anti- superhero satire in the vein of Mystery Men, is juvenile, amateurish, incompetent, and very boring. The voices are hit and miss, mostly miss. One bright spot was the decent artwork and coloring (hopefully the artists didn't donate their time), but it can't save this lame story. Do not watch unless you're a masochist.
